The Science of Intelligence meets the Engineering of Intelligence
The MIT Siegel Family Quest for Intelligence is a community of scientists, engineers, faculty, students, staff, and supporters that aim to understand intelligence – how brains produce it and how it can be replicated in artificial systems. Together, we approach intelligence as a single grand challenge requiring the organized, collaborative efforts of science, engineering, the humanities, and beyond. To achieve this vision, scientific theories of natural intelligence must be developed, computational models must be created, and these models must be compared against the capabilities and neural mechanisms of natural intelligence and tested on real-world problems.
Working across the whole of MIT and with the world at large, the Quest capitalizes on MIT’s long history of leadership at the boundary of natural and machine intelligence. It is uniquely positioned to advance the development of novel intelligent systems and associated tools and technologies, which will yield countless societal benefits and applications in numerous fields. The Quest’s approach does not merely require a crossing of boundaries, but a true integration across disciplines. While recent progress illustrates the mutual benefit of studying natural intelligence and engineered intelligent systems, we believe transformative advances in intelligence require a new approach that more closely integrates the science of natural intelligence with the engineering and applications of artificial intelligence.
